Lead, Kindly Light
Word,s by J.H.Newman
Music,s by J.B.Dykes
Lead, kindly Light, amidth'encircling gloom,
Lead Thou me on,
The night is dark, and I am far from home;
Lead Thou me on;
Keep Thou my feet; I do not ask to see
The distant scene, one step enough for me.
2.
I was not ever thus, nor prayed that Thou
Shouldst lead me on;
I loved to choose and see my path, but now
Lead Thou me on.
I loved the garish day, and, spite of fears,
Pride ruled my will; remember not past years.
3.
So long Thy power hath blest me sure it still
Will lead me on;
O'er moor and fen, o'er crag and torrent, till
The night is gone.
And with the morn those angel faces smile
Which I have loved long since, and lost awhile
